Geopoetic visit "Yellow Butter"

The former open-pit excavations are now part of the central zones of the Minett biosphere reserve, focusing on the coexistence of humans and nature. During a guided hike under the spring hues, we will learn how humans have shaped the landscape and its geological substrate. Explanations by a geoscience expert and readings from the travel journal 'Rocklines' as well as texts by Nico Helminger and Henry David Thoreau will complement this exploration of 'Giele Botter'.
